Fort Worth (and vicinity) attractions for couples
In the greater Fort Worth area, families and adventurous travellers will find a wealth of activities that promise both excitement and enrichment. Begin your exploration at the renowned Fort Worth Zoo, home to over 7,000 animals and an engaging array of exhibits, including the stunning Asian Falls, where children can marvel at exotic wildlife in a lush setting. A short drive away leads you to the Fort Worth Museum of Science and History, where interactive displays and the planetarium ignite curiosity in both young and old. For a taste of local culture, the Fort Worth Stockyards National Historic District offers a glimpse into Texas' cowboy heritage, with daily cattle drives and the chance to stroll along the historic streets lined with shops and eateries. Art enthusiasts will appreciate the Kimbell Art Museum, known for its impressive collection and stunning architecture, providing a serene retreat after a day of exploration. Finally, no visit would be complete without experiencing the vibrant atmosphere of the Fort Worth Water Gardens, where families can enjoy the soothing sounds of cascading water in this urban oasis.
